 PostPosted: Wed Apr 08, 2009 11:24 am Post subject: 
 
Philes wrote:
Does the increased sight range have any ill-effects? Like, scripting for seeing enemies or the like?

No, not really.
Philes wrote:
Do you see any artifacts resulting from the game designers not texturing parts of maps out that far since they didn't think people would see them?

Well, for one thing you can scroll pretty far at the original 800x600, especially with PE20. Now you can see more without having to scroll as much. The patch also adjusts scrolling distance according to the resolution, so you can't scroll farther than at 800x600.

 PostPosted: Wed Apr 08, 2009 3:14 pm Post subject: 
 
Frigo wrote:
The increased sight range by NPCs might cause some problems if you try to rob the mages in tarant.

NPCs' sight range is dependent on lighting and PE checks. Resolution has nothing to do with it.

The player character's PE influences the distance you can scroll the screen away from your main character, and all evidence points to that NPC sight is bugged so that they are unable (or less likely) to see the PC screwing around with their stuff if they are not on screen. This way it is possible to rob the mages in broad daylight, even with the soundstrom that Unlocking Cantrip causes. It is difficult to pull off, nonetheless.

Let me mention another thing, though. Everything that is 31 tiles away from the PC is inactive, i.e. AI, animation, scripts, etc don't work there. That's why I'm adjusting scrolling distance, so that you won't be able to scroll away farther than at 800x600 and see such areas at higher resolutions. However, they will be inevitable at resolutions like 2600x1900 (since such things will get visible even without scrolling). I may increase the radius later, though, if there is a demand for such extreme resolutions.

You can see this for yourself. If you run the game with '-scrolldist:0' switch you will get infinite scrolling distance and will be able to see inactive objects.
